Botcha thanks Prez for Ordinance; Flays TD on naming Intl Airport after NTR

Former APCC Chief, Botcha Satyanarayana today flayed Telugu Desam for its efforts to rename Rajiv Gandhi International Airport (Shamshabad) as NTR airport.
Talking to press persons here Satyanarayana alleged that the TD is indulging in false prestige at the behest of the BJP Government at the Centre. AP Chief Minister in waiting N Chandrababu Naidu can name Gannavaram Airport near Vijayawada after NTR instead, he said. Extending thanks to President Pranab Mukherjee for approval of Polavaram Ordinance giving seven mandals to AP State, he said that the Congress led UPA Government proposed the same. The Congress leader flayed the TRS for opposing the ordinance. Telangana state was carved out even when Seemandhra people opposed it, he said appealing that T leaders and people should accept to give seven mandals to AP state.

Botcha made this comment soon after Union Civil Aviation Minister Ashok Gajapathi Raju stated that Rajiv Gandhi Airport will be named after NTR. Botcha criticized that TD Chief N Chandrababu Naidu preferred to take on the Congress instead of creating confidence among public on his developmental programs in AP State.(NSS)
